About The Position

OMAX Waterjet is seeking an experienced Quality Technician to join their team in Kent, Washington. This role involves performing inspections, audits, gauge use/calibration, and troubleshooting activities. The ideal candidate will thrive in a fast-paced environment, be adaptable, and possess strong communication skills. Hypertherm Associates, the parent company, emphasizes a clean, safe, and supportive manufacturing environment, offering opportunities for growth and contribution to a 100% Associate-owned company. They are committed to process improvement, environmental impact reduction, quality enhancement, cost reduction, and increasing shared profits.

Requirements

  • 18 years or older
  • High School Diploma or GED
  • Demonstrated competence in the use of quality procedures, measurement systems, and print reading
  • Accurate and well-organized work, good documentation, attention to detail, and communication skills (written and verbal)
  • Comfortable using computers, including Microsoft Office suite (Outlook, Excel, PowerPoint)
  • Demonstrated ability to prioritize and manage multiple tasks
  • Demonstrated ability to communicate effectively when relaying technical information
  • Desire and drive to obtain ASQ quality certifications
  • Demonstrated ability to work productively in a team environment

Nice To Haves

  • CMM/PCDMIS programming/troubleshooting experience is heavily preferred
  • CQT or CQI Certification
  • Proficiency with interpreting standards (Y14.5M)
  • Ability to train and mentor others
  • Gagetrak
  • Minitab
  • Solidworks
  • 6-sigma/Lean certifications

Responsibilities

  • Perform activities such as measurement, inspection, gauge tracking, calibrations, audits, and troubleshooting
  • Communicate effectively to internal customers
  • Understand and apply basic quality tools (5Why, Pareto Analysis, Check Sheets, etc.)
  • Perform tasks using basic skills in mathematics, metrology, calibration, and quality
  • Provide support to other Associates in gauge/instrument use, troubleshooting, and repair
  • Be an active part of continuous improvement activities such as kaizen, 3P, and other lean events
  • Perform tasks following the control of non-conforming material process
